Just did bi's and tri's.. Doing tri's I can get them pumped and rock hard from top to bottom,, its different with bi's though, bottom half is pumped and rock hard and where my tshirt starts its like I just rocked up.. Soft as my ass.. Any way to target that area?

Haha so many of them in my gym mate. The way I found to hut that area is do bicep curls with cables at shoulder height so you look like your trying to flex. Now, turn your wrist out as far as possible without hurting. Do curls like this and emphasize the squeeze.. Best way to see if it's working is feel the muscle a you do it. Just tense your arm bow twist your wrist back nd forth, you with feel your upper outer bi working!
